Robert (Bob) Brodt commented on JBIDE-8531:
-------------------------------------------
I think the idea is that we shouldn't copy resources whenever they're needed in
different projects. The deployer needs to copy them to the server (or zip them up in the
deployment package). This will also affect the editor which, by default, does not support
imports from other projects - it may require some thought how to handle that.
WSDL files should be accessible to BPEL project from another project
(without copying)

SOA-P 5.2 PRD document requirement SOA-TOOL-2:
The SOA-5.2 PRD requirements include the ability of a BPEL project to reference WSDLs
(and probably XSDs as well) in another project without having to make copies. The
assumption is that all resources are in the same eclipse workspace, not in a file system
folder or remote server.
